Chelsea manager soothes Eden Hazard worries as Real Madrid monitor situation

JOSE MOURINHO insists Eden Hazard is back to his best after a faltering start to the season.

Hazard failed to score in his first nine games of the new campaign, resulting in him being benched for a crucial Champions League clash in Porto.

The Belgian came on as a second-half substitute but couldn’t prevent Chelsea going down 2-1 to the Portuguese champions.

He was dropped again following Chelsea’s disastrous 3-1 home loss to Southampton before the most recent international break - and was then heavily criticised for his performance against Dynamo Kiev in Europe.
